Jake Tonges vs Tyler Conklin: The Full Breakdown

This is a genuine coin flip on paper. Jake Tonges finished the 2025 season at 8.5 PPG over 9 games with the San Francisco 49ers, while Tyler Conklin clocked in at 7.5 across 17 appearances for the New York Jets. A 1.0-point gap means any given week could go either way.

With a margin this thin, season averages are not the deciding factor. Weekly variables like opponent defense, game script, and injury status carry more weight than a fraction of a PPG. The right start in Week 6 might be the wrong start in Week 14.

Tyler Conklin is the volume tight end in this matchup with 50 receptions for 525 yards, while Jake Tonges profiles as a more touchdown-dependent spike play (5 scores on 34 catches). In weeks where Jake Tonges finds the end zone he out-scores Tyler Conklin, but the floor gap is real.
